The distribution F () = 1 – E (–), 0 < 1; 0 , where E (x) is the Mittag-Leffler function is studied here with respect to its Laplace transform. Its infinite divisibility and geometric infinite divisibility are proved, along with many other properties. Its relation with stable distribution is established. The Mittag-Leffler process is defined and some of its properties are deduced.  相似文献

Hecke groups H(q) are the discrete subgroups of generated by S(z) = –(z+ q)–1and T(z) = –1/z. The commutator subgroup of H(q), denoted by H(q), is studied in [2]. It was shown that H(q) is a free group of rank q– 1.Here the extended Hecke groups obtained by adjoining to the generators of H(q) are considered. The commutator subgroup of is shown to be a free product of two finite cyclic groups. Also it is interesting to note that while in the H(q) case, the index of H(q) is changed by q, in the case of this number is either 4 for qodd or 8 for qeven.  相似文献

The equation 2–(3+a 22+a 1+a 0)=0, which is encountered in problems of mechanics, is considered in the work. It has two singular points: a regular singular point at zero and an irregular singular point at infinity. A fundamental family of solutions (f.f.s.) can be constructed in the form of integrals of Mellin-Barns type where the integrand satisfies a linear difference equation with polynomial coefficients. On the basis of this representation a f.f.s. is constructed in a neighborhood of zero, and its asymptotics at infinity is found. The coefficients of this asymptotics (the coupling factors) can be represented in the form of analytic expressions containing certain solutions of the difference equation adjoint to the difference equation previously mentioned. In contrast to previous works of the author, the general case of the initial equation is investigated.Translated from Zapiski Nauchnykh Seminarov Leningradskogo Otdeleniya Matematicheskogo Instituta im. The spectrum (G) of a finite group G is the set of element orders of G. A finite group G is said to be recognizable by spectrum (briefly, recognizable) if HG for every finite group H such that (H)=(G). We give two series, infinite by dimension, of finite simple classical groups recognizable by spectrum.  相似文献
